What Platelets Are actually and Why They Issue
Platelets, or even thrombocytes, are little, disc-shaped tissue particles originated from megakaryocytes in the bone tissue bottom. Unlike red or leukocyte, they carry out certainly not possess a center. Their major role is to keep hemostasis– the procedure that ceases bleeding.
When a capillary is hurt, platelets rapidly stick to the wrecked web site, come to be triggered, as well as accumulation to develop a short-term “connect.” This plug is later stabilized by fibrin during coagulation. Without platelets, also slight personal injuries might lead to unchecked blood loss. bone marrow benefits
Under ordinary microscopic evaluation of a well-prepared blood stream smear, platelets look like little purple-staining dots dispersed in between red blood cells. They should be equally dispersed. When they show up arranged in to clusters, having said that, it questions regarding whether the looking for demonstrates a natural problem or even a laboratory artifact. are chills a sign of cancer
Just How Platelet Clumps Show Up Under the Microscopic lense
Platelet clumping is generally monitored in tangential blood stream smears discolored along with Wright-Giemsa or identical blemishes. As opposed to being actually evenly distributed, platelets seem like:
Thick accumulations of multiple platelets
Irregular sets along the edges of the smear
Collections around white blood cells or even debris
At times, sizable lumps that imitate a solitary leukocyte or even overseas component
These bunches can easily differ from small groups of a couple of platelets to sizable accumulations that dramatically misshape automated platelet counts.
Oftentimes, platelet globs are first suspected when an automated hematology analyzer mentions an extraordinarily low platelet matter (thrombocytopenia), however manual smear customer review presents creatively typical or maybe plentiful platelets.
Root Causes Of Platelet Clumping
Platelet gathering observed under the microscopic lense may develop coming from both artificial insemination (outside the physical body) and in vivo (inside the body) induces. Having said that, very most commonly it is actually an artefact of blood assortment or dealing with.
1. EDTA-Dependent Pseudothrombocytopenia
One of the most well-known reasons is EDTA-induced platelet clumping. Ethylenediaminetetraacetic acid (EDTA) is an anticoagulant made use of in blood selection tubes. In some individuals, EDTA changes platelet area proteins, leaving open antigens that result in platelets to stick.
This ailment does certainly not reflect true illness but may bring about wrongly low platelet depend on automated devices.
2. Incorrect Example Handling
Delayed smear arrangement, too much frustration, or wrong storage space temperature levels can advertise platelet activation and gathering.
3. Cold Agglutinins as well as Temperature Impacts
In rare scenarios, exposure of blood samples to low temperatures can easily induce platelet or even healthy protein interactions that promote concentration.
4. Real Pathological Causes
Less generally, platelet clumping might demonstrate real bodily processes, including:
Serious inflammatory states
Shared intravascular coagulation (DIC).
Myeloproliferative disorders.
Having said that, in these health conditions, barging is actually often alonged with various other abnormal hematologic lookings for.
Why Platelet Clumps Issue in Prognosis.
In the beginning look, platelet clumps might look like a slight laboratory nuisance. Essentially, they may have considerable analysis implications.
1. Pseudothrombocytopenia and Misdiagnosis.
One of the most critical problem is actually misleading prognosis of thrombocytopenia. A client might be wrongly classified as having a bleeding disorder, triggering unnecessary loyal testing, anxiousness, or maybe unsuitable therapy.
2. Impact on Clinical Choices.
Platelet counts are vital in:.
Surgical preparation.
Chemotherapy tracking.
Examining bleeding danger.
An incorrectly low platelet matter as a result of stumbling can easily put off procedures or even affect treatment plannings unnecessarily.
3. Laboratory Quality Assurance.
Microscopic detection of platelet globs is an essential part of hematology quality control. It ensures that automated analyzers are legitimized and that irregular outcomes are analyzed appropriately.
Minuscule Acknowledgment as well as Laboratory Approaches.
Research laboratory experts use numerous techniques to validate platelet clumping:.
Peripheral Blood Stream Smear Assessment.
A skilled engineer examines stained blood stream films under higher magnifying (usually 1000x with oil engrossment). This remains the gold specification for locating clumps.
Loyal Trying Out along with Alternate Anticoagulants.
If EDTA-induced clumping is presumed, blood might be recollected making use of salt citrate or even heparin pipes to establish whether platelet awaits stabilize.
Handbook Platelet Evaluation.
Instead of relying solely on automated counts, platelets are actually determined aesthetically by comparing all of them to red blood cells in defined microscope areas.
Automated Analyzer Flags.
Modern hematology analyzers often flag “platelet gathering felt,” urging manual review.
Biological Insight: What Clumping Shows Concerning Platelets.
Past laboratory artefacts, platelet clumping delivers idea in to platelet biology. Platelets are inherently adhesive cells made to accumulation quickly when switched on. The reality that they often accumulation outside the physical body highlights their sensitivity to environmental modifications.
This level of sensitivity is moderated by area receptors including glycoprotein IIb/IIIa, which ties fibrinogen in the course of gathering. When these receptors are exposed or even affected in the course of blood collection, unplanned concentration can happen even without general accident.
Hence, platelet lumps under the microscopic lense act as a tip of how simply the hemostatic system can be set off.
Differentiating Artefact from Health Condition.
An essential skill in hematology is comparing correct thrombocytopenia as well as pseudothrombocytopenia. The existence of platelet globs is actually a major clue directing toward the second.
Functions advising an artifact consist of:.
Normal individual background without blood loss indicators.
Platelet globs observed merely in EDTA cylinders.
Typical platelet count in citrate or heparin samples.
Otherwise normal blood morphology.
However, true pathological thrombocytopenia commonly shows:.
No clumping artefact.
Extraordinarily low platelet amounts all over all examples.
Added oddities in red or even white blood cells.
